Bind service account iam terraform

WebApr 10, 2024 · In this part, we will: Run FAST stages/0-bootstrap — to configure automation, billing, and log export projects, custom roles, service accounts, organisation-level logging, and workload identity ... Web13 rows · one optional billing IAM role binding per service account, at the organization …

Configuring a Kubernetes service account to assume an …

WebDec 5, 2024 · A service account can be looked at as both a principal and a resource. This is because you can grant a service account a role (like an identity) and attach policies to it (like a resource).... WebSep 2, 2024 · Creating a Service Account We select our root project, we click the IAM & Admin menu, Service Accounts option, and finally, on the + Create Service Account button. Google Cloud... simpson nailess bridging https://veritasevangelicalseminary.com

Build a Modern Platform with Crossplane, Anthos and ArgoCD

WebJan 27, 1993 · Create an IAM role and associate it with a Kubernetes service account. You can use either eksctl or the AWS CLI. anchor anchor eksctl AWS CLI Prerequisite Version 0.135.0 or later of the eksctl command line tool installed on your device or AWS CloudShell. To install or update eksctl, see Installing or updating eksctl. WebJan 13, 2024 · terraform-provider-google-beta 2.5 Permissions In order to execute a submodule you must have a Service Account with an appropriate role to manage IAM for the applicable resource. The appropriate role differs depending on which resource you are targeting, as follows: Organization: WebMay 14, 2024 · A credentials JSON file from that account — this can be generated using: gcloud iam service-accounts keys create credentials.json --iam-account={iam-account-email} We will start by setting up ... simpson mustache arrowhead

How to Manage Google Groups, Users and Service Accounts in …

Category:How to add bind a role to service account? #1225 - Github

Tags:Bind service account iam terraform

Bind service account iam terraform

terraform-google-modules/terraform-google-service-accounts - Github

WebTerraform Cloud Account; Google Cloud Account; Harness Free Tier; Git Repositories. The demo uses the following git repositories a sources, vanilla-gke - the terraform source repository that will be used with terraform cloud to provision the GKE. bootstrap-argocd - the repository that holds kubernetes manifests to bootstrap argo CD on to the ... WebserviceAccount: {emailid}: An email address that represents a service account. For example, [email protected]. group: {emailid}: An email address that represents a Google group. For example, [email protected]. domain: {domain}: A G Suite domain (primary, instead of alias) name that represents all the users of that domain.

Bind service account iam terraform

Did you know?

WebJan 27, 1993 · Create an IAM role and associate it with a Kubernetes service account. You can use either eksctl or the AWS CLI. anchor anchor eksctl AWS CLI Prerequisite … WebDec 5, 2024 · A service account can be looked at as both a principal and a resource. This is because you can grant a service account a role (like an identity) and attach policies to it (like a resource)....

WebMay 23, 2024 · How to Create a Service Account for Terraform in GCP (Google Cloud Platform) by Guillermo Musumeci Medium Guillermo Musumeci 2.3K Followers Certified AWS, Azure & GCP Architect HashiCorp... WebEach of these resources serves a different use case: google_cloudiot_registry_iam_policy: Authoritative. Sets the IAM policy for the deviceregistry and replaces any existing policy already attached. google_cloudiot_registry_iam_binding: Authoritative for a given role. Updates the IAM policy to grant a role to a list of members.

WebApr 5, 2024 · Pub/Sub IAM is useful for fine-tuning access in cross-project communication. For example, suppose a service account in Cloud Project A wants to publish messages to a topic in Cloud Project B. You could accomplish this by granting the service account Edit permission in Cloud Project B. However, this approach is often too coarse. WebUse Provider IAM policy for service account When managing IAM roles, you can treat a service account either as a resource or as an identity. This resource is to add iam …

WebApr 9, 2024 · gcloud iam service-accounts keys create key.json [email protected] Step 3.2 Authenticate service account using JSON key created:

WebMar 27, 2024 · 1. Create a service account from your GCP console, and attach the below roles to it. a. Role Administrator. b. Security Admin, d. Service Account Key Admin 2. … simpson mudsill anchorWebIAM roles for service accounts provide the following benefits: Least privilege – You can scope IAM permissions to a service account, and only pods that use that service account have access to those permissions. This feature also eliminates the need for third-party solutions such as kiam or kube2iam. simpson nc post office hoursWeb> gcloud iam service-accounts get-iam-policy [email protected] bindings: - members: - serviceAccount:[email protected] role: roles/iam.serviceAccountUser etag: BwWMpQvtA3w= version: 1 The template is configured as follows: razer thresher gaming headset for ps4WebЯ создал сервисную учетную запись [email protected].. Следуя лучшим практикам GCP, я хотел бы использовать ее для того, чтобы запускать GCE VM с именем instance-1 (еще не созданную).. Эта VM должна уметь писать логи и ... simpson mudsill anchor strapsWebApr 11, 2024 · The service you are using. The project from which you are using the service. The operation or long-running operation returned by certain methods. Each Service Usage method requires a permission on one or more of these resources. IAM permissions. The following table shows the required permissions for each Service … simpson murder case bookWebService Account: Service Account Admin: Create and manage service accounts. Custom: Add resourcemanager.organizations.getIamPolicy and resourcemanager.organizations.setIamPolicy permissions. Subnetwork: Project compute admin: Full control of Compute Engine resources. razer thresher for xbox oneWebIAM binding imports use space-delimited identifiers; the resource in question and the role. This binding resource can be imported using the project_id and role, e.g. terraform … simpson neighborhood